Hello I have been keeping sps for going on one year now and everything has been going good. My tank tends to be a bit of a high nutrient tank but colors and growth are good. Over the past 2 months I did get a good bit of hair algae on the back wall of my tank and just a bit on the rocks. I got to where I could not stand the back wall anymore so I manually removed almost all of the hair algae in one go. Over the next 2 days I have a handful of my sps lose color and begin to bleach out. Still has some color and did not turn white but still a very nocitable change. The others seem unaffected. Tested the water and the results are below.

Alk 9.0
Cal 430
Mag 1400
Phos.17 Hanna
Nitrates <10ppm

If you have any ideas please let me know. Thanks.

SPS can handle a wide range of paremeters including nutrient levels. They do not like rapid changes. The key is stability. Do the parameters you mention match the ones a week ago?

jpruitt
05/07/2017, 02:36 AM
Po4 after removing the hair algae on the back glass and one 40 gallon water change went from 107 on the Hanna URL to 56. So phosphates went down about half. That is the only change.
